Saifuddin Zuhri Purwokerto, Purwokerto, Indonesia 2 Institut Agama Islam Negeri Kudus, Kudus, Indonesia email: nurkhasanah71812@gmail.com Received July 17, 2023 Accepted November 22, 2023 Published November 27, 2023 Abstract: This study aimed to determine the effectiveness of the GI-type cooperative learning model assisted by comic media in improving the mathematical literacy skills of the eighth-grade students of SMP Negeri 1 Punggelan. This research was experimental research with a quantitative approach. The population in this study were students of the eighth grade of SMP Negeri 1 Punggelan and the samples used were taken by simple random sampling technique. The sample results obtained were students of VIII G and VIII H, consisting of 58 students. The instrument used in this study was a description test consisting of a pretest and a posttest. The results of this study showed that the average mathematical literacy ability of students who were subjected to the GI-type cooperative learning model assisted by comic media was better than those who were not subjected to it, as seen from the results of the N- Gain test, namely the experimental class obtained an average N-Gain value of 0 .77 with high criteria, while in the control class, the average N-Gain value for the control class was 0.47 with moderate criteria. In the t-test, the two independent samples showed a significant result of 0.000 <0.05, meaning that there was a significant difference in students' mathematical literacy skills between the experimental and control classes. The GI-type cooperative learning model assisted by comic media was shown to be effective for increasing mathematical literacy skills with the average N-Gain test results obtained in the experimental class by 77% with effective criteria and in the control class by 47% with less effective criteria. Introduction Mathematics is a way to find answers to problems faced by humans, namely a way of using information, knowledge of shape and size, knowledge of counting. According to Content Standards (SI), the objectives of the mathematics subject show that the curriculum is structured with attention to aspects of mathematical literacy (BSNP, 2006). This is because mathematical literacy is very important for everyone because it can help someone to recognize the role of mathematics in the real world and make the necessary considerations and decisions. Mathematical literacy ability is the ability to formulate, apply, and interpret mathematics in various contexts. With mathematical literacy students can develop and apply mathematical knowledge in the real world.
